Six solar PV successes

Building supplies company Gibbs & Dandy has helped Multicraft Electrical Services secure six lucrative solar PV contracts, delivering home energy micro-generation.

The Bedford based electrical manufacturer and wholesaler has installed photovoltaic panels on six homes in the local area, enabling them to sustainably produce electricity, whilst benefiting from the government’s feed-in tariffs.

Using its supplier network and growing experience within the renewables industry, Gibbs & Dandy were able to source solar PV products for all six installations, supplying them on time and within budget.

In addition to sourcing the complete solar PV kits from Saint Gobain Solar, which include modules, mounting brackets, G83 compliant inverter, AC and DC isolators, single phase in-line kWh metre, cables and adapters, the builders’ merchant also helped advise on solutions for the varying project demands, through its in-store renewables experts.

To allow the homeowners to fully benefit from the government’s feed-in tariffs, Multicraft Electrical Services, also had to ensure they were MCS qualified. The trade professionals achieved their qualifications through the Greenworks Academy, a shared initiative from Gibbs & Dandy and its sister brands.

Gareth Hughes, Director of Renewable Energy for Multicraft Electrical Services, said: “Home energy micro-generation, and solar PV in particular, is really growing in popularity throughout Bedford, and we’ve noticed a considerable increase in requests for quotes. The feed-in tariffs, as they stand, are still a massive incentive but combined with rising energy prices and heightened awareness of environmental factors, solar PV is a real growth market.

“We were keen to diversify our business offering into this field, and the training and support we received from Gibbs & Dandy and its Greenworks Training Academy enabled us to expand as a business and benefit from some profitable projects.

“Gibbs & Dandy has provided product and support throughout the training, specification and installation process, which is vital when working with new or unfamiliar technologies. This has enabled us to capitalise on this emerging trend and meet customer demand.”

Rob Slater, renewables champion for Gibbs & Dandy in Bedford added: “We’re really pleased to have worked with a customer who is keen to expand its business offering and genuinely appreciates the benefits of solar PV technology. Our MCS training courses are specifically designed for companies, like Multicraft Services, who want to grow new areas of the business and benefits from Government schemes, like the feed-in tariffs and upcoming Green Deal, but are unsure of the skills and issues involved.

“Plus, with our extensive sustainable product range we can advise and supply for almost any specification, which is a great boost for installers looking to win more work in this area. This is our largest success to date and we look forward to helping more businesses expand into sustainable technologies.”
